Weather: The Weather application will automatically geo locate you when installing, and display the closest city weather forecast. A browser icon indicates the daily forecast and temperature. Get instant geo location and localization, and forecasts in your language you will be able to get a quick access to any of your favorite places, and you will also get some real time notifications on weather changes.

Weather Forecasts: There is no need of taking much efforts. You just have to input a name of the city you want, and you’re done! It will bring you to the subscription to the global meteorological conditions of that particular city. It also provides you the detailed information regarding current meteorological data.

Currently: Currently is a simple Chrome extension that replaces your "New Tab" screen with a new one that shows you the current time and the weather. There is no need of adding any information manually. This smart extension will start serving you the weather reports on a “New Tab” screen right fetching your server’s location.

WeatherSpark: WeatherSpark is a new type of weather reporting system with interactive weather graphs. These weather graphs lets you panning and zooming the entire history of any weather station on earth. You will easily get multiple forecasts for the current location, overlaid on records and averages to put it all in context.

WeatherByte: WeatherByte is a clean and simple weather application that helps you showing current weather and forecast. This extension is based on a simple user interface with a display great compatibility on Computers, Tablets, Google TV, Boxee Box etc.

Webcam Toy: Digital Effects & Filters To Use With Webcam

Using webcam is always fun but using it with some cool effects is more entertaining, isn't it? 'Webcam Toy' extension for chrome allows users to explore 60 fun digital effects and filters to use with their webcam. You can play with loads of fun camera effects and filters, take photos, download to save on your computer or post them straight to Twitter and Facebook. How to use Webcam Toy? First, you need to allow access to your web camera when prompted. After that, choose your webcam from the list available. Then, choose a type of effect from the menu in the lower half of the screen by pressing the left or right arrows. Finally, take a picture by pressing the camera button, then choose to download or share.          Keyboard shortcut keys in the App: Arrow keys - Go to previous/next effect. Beta channel has been updated to 24.0.1312.27

Another rapid update is coming from Google Chrome Releases. We recently posted an update regrading latest stable channel version 23 for Google Chrome browser, and now we have a news about Beta channel development. The Beta channel has been updated to 24.0.1312.27  for Windows, Mac, Linux, and Chrome Frame.  This build contains following updates: Fixed random Chinese/Japanese characters that are missing in documents printed via the system print dialog on Windows XP SP3. [Issue: 128506 ] Fixed memory leak in  GPU accelerated canvas. [Issue: 160411 ] Fixed console.log which doesn’t output jQuery objects properly. [Issue: 162570 ] Fixed stability issues like 161854 , 154483 , 154462 , 153376 . Full details about the changes made in this build by Chrome team are available in the SVN revision log .
